LaunchKey Authenticator SDK

Overview

LaunchKey authenticator SDK brings the security and capabilities of the LaunchKey multi-factor authentication and real-time authorization platform to your own Mobile App through a simple mobile SDK. Instead of your users using the LaunchKey Mobile Authenticator to authenticate and authorize an Auth Request sent from your service, LaunchKey authenticator places a hidden Auth Modal that slides into view above your Mobile App as needed, and provides your Users with the same functionality found in the LaunchKey Mobile Authenticator. Additionally, some of methods within the Authenticator SDK are exposed to your Mobile App so that you can perform these functions directly within your Mobile App instead of the Auth Modal.

Integration Components

To use the LaunchKey authenticator, you will be working with three primary LaunchKey components:

  1. Authenticator SDK - The Authenticator SDK gives your Mobile App developers a simple and quick way to turn your iOS or Android mobile app into a LaunchKey powered authenticator. This drop-in SDK embeds a customizable LaunchKey modal that lives within your Mobile App and gives your users the ability to authenticate and respond to the Auth Requests from your service.
  2. LaunchKey Dashboard - This is your command and control center for your developers and administrators to create and manage services, manage organizations, set security policies, provision users, view analytics and logs, and more. Follow this link to the Dashboard.
  3. LaunchKey Platform API - In order to send and process the Auth requests that your services sends your users, it must interface with the Platform API. Among other things, our API routes your service's encrypted Auth Requests and your User’s encrypted responses between your services and their mobile devices. To make things easier, we have SDKs available in every major programming language.

Integration Steps

  1. For version 3.0.1 of the Android SDK, go straight to Integrating LaunchKey with Android
  2. For version 3.0.0 of the iOS SDK, go straight to Integrating LaunchKey with iOS

For previous versions of the SDKs, see:

  1. Before You Begin
  2. Create Directory & Service
  3. Integrate the Authenticator SDK
  4. Configure Your Service

User Contributed

LaunchKey links to user contributed code as a resource to its community. LaunchKey does not in any way guarantee or warrant the quality and security of these code bases. User contributed code is supported by the creators. If you do find a link from the site to user contributed code that is malicious or inappropriate in any way, please report that link to LaunchKey immediately and we will investigate the claim. Submit any issue to LaunchKey support at https://launchkey.com./support. ×